CHARLESTON, W.Va. - The Golden Eagle men's tennis team easily dismantled their Kanawha Valley Mountain East Conference counterpart West Virginia State University by a 9-0 score at Schoenbaum Tennis Courts. The clean sweep of the Yellow Jackets stopped a two-match losing streak by the Golden Eagles.
UC was able to insert some new players in the lineup as both Jacob Adkins and Faron Williamson saw action in doubles and singles in the win. Â Charleston failed to drop a set to the visiting Jackets, improving their unbeaten MEC record to 4-0.
